Tipping is a great way to show appreciation for a job well done. On Fiverr, clients can easily leave a tip for their freelancer after completing an order.
When can I leave a tip?
- You can tip your freelancer once the order is marked as Complete.
The “Tip Now” option appears:
After leaving a review on the web. - Immediately after order completion on the Fiverr app (no review required)
- For Hourly orders, the tip option becomes available once the contract is completed and a review is added.
The tipping window is open for 30 days after the order is marked as complete.
How much can I tip?
- Minimum tip: $5
- Tip limits based on order value:
For orders below $25 → Tip up to $25
For orders $25 or more → Tip up to 100% of the order value
How does payment work?
- When you click “Tip Now”, funds will first be deducted from your Fiverr Balance.
- If your balance is insufficient, a payment window will open, allowing you to complete the transaction using an alternative method.
- Tips are charged with Fiverr’s standard service fee.

Just like regular payments, tips follow the 14-day clearance period before being available in the freelancer’s account.
Tips will appear as a separate line on the Revenue page and generate separate invoices, as they are counted as distinct transactions.
- If you're unable to leave a tip, check the following:
- The order must be marked as Complete.
- On desktop/web, you must leave a review first before tipping.
- The 30-day tipping window may have passed.
If more than 30 days have passed since your order was completed, the Tip Now option will no longer be available. However, you can still show appreciation by:
- Contact your freelancer via the inbox.
- Ask them to create a Custom Offer for a new order in the amount you'd like to tip.
If you proceed this way, be sure to mention clearly in the new order that the payment is intended as a tip for a previous project. This ensures transparency and helps avoid disputes if the order is reviewed.
